In the pantheon of body horror, few films test the limits of the viewer’s stomach quite like Éric Falardeau’s 2012 debut, . Translating roughly to the “visible signs of death,” the film is a 90-minute slow-burn depiction of a young woman, Laura (Kayden Rose), literally rotting alive. Summary: Thanatomorphose follows the disintegrating life of Laura, a young woman who wakes to find her body inexplicably decaying. As her physical condition worsens, her mental state frays; isolation, guilt, and self-neglect push her toward ever more extreme acts. The film blends body-horror imagery with psychological portraiture, using visceral practical effects to chart bodily dissolution as metaphor for emotional collapse.
